4 votos

ffmpeg argumentos utilizados para la conversión a mp4

Me han sugerido dos diferentes ffmpeg comandos para convertir un archivo mkv a mp4, mientras que sólo la re-codificación de audio (aac) y dejando la parte de vídeo como es. Aquí están los dos comandos:

  1. ffmpeg -loglevel panic -i source.mkv -vcodec copy -c:a aac -strict -2 -ab 160k -ac 2 -ar 48k target.mp4

  2. ffmpeg -i source.mkv -c:v copy -c:a aac -b:a 384k -strict -2 target.mp4

Podría alguien por favor explique la diferencia? OK, más precisamente, tengo curiosidad acerca de las cosas que el primer comando en adición a lo que el segundo no. Es necesario el uso de un registro de nivel de pánico argumento? ¿Qué sucede si es omitido?

Entiendo que el segundo comando a fondo. Pero los argumentos adicionales en la primera se me confunde y no he encontrado mucha ayuda en el ffmpeg documentación . En particular, quiero entender lo que el -ca, -ar, y -ab argumentos lograr y por qué no se usa en el segundo comando.

3voto

chillin Puntos 1997

ffmpeg duplicados de sintaxis. Excepto para los valores utilizados, y que el primer comando ajustar la tasa de muestreo en lugar de utilizar el valor predeterminado, los comandos son efectivamente los mismos:

 -loglevel panic  - merely makes ffmpeg less noisy in the shell
 -vcodec copy     = -c:v copy
 -acodec copy     = -c:a copy   # unlisted in the command, but listing here to show there is consistency
 -ab              = -b:a

Nota: La otra respuesta que la información es correcta.

Hay una guía en línea; listas de lo que cualquier posible argumento de medios.

2voto

Steve Evans Puntos 155

Las tres banderas pedir una de 2 canales, 48000 Hz muestreados, de 160 kb de tasa de bits codificados en la pista de audio.

Las banderas que se puede pasar a ffmpeg se enumeran en el ffmpeg página de manual. Las páginas de Manual tienden a ser conciso pero informativo:

ca

-ac channels

Establecer el número de canales de audio (por defecto = 1).

ar

-ar freq

Establecer la frecuencia de muestreo de audio (por defecto = 44100 Hz).

ab

-ab bitrate

Establecer el bitrate de audio en bit/s (por defecto = 64 kb).

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X